isPermaLink="false">http://newsfromcarnivalcruiselines.wordpress.com/?p=199</guid> <description><![CDATA[  In two separate ceremonies, Carnival Cruise Lines presented San Diego-based America’s Vacation Center and North Potomac, Md.-based The Cruise Line Ltd. with its Agency of the Year Awards. For the first time, Carnival recognized two agencies for this award. Nominees were selected from more than 30,000 cruise-selling travel agencies throughout the U.S. and Canada.
